PWM-dimmer
PWM-dimmer
Försöker bygga en dimmer mha en pwm-krets jag gjorde för ett tag sen. Tänkte låta den mata en FET. Men jag är lite osäker på mina idéer. Ska jag lägga matningsspänning på lampans ena pol och koppla drain till den andra, och source till jord?
En lite lat beskrivning kanske, men jag tror ni fattar ändå
En lite lat beskrivning kanske, men jag tror ni fattar ändå
Där få man för att man är lat nädå, skämt åsido.
Har en halogen lampa för 12 V och tillgång till 12 V från batteri. För att spara energi vill jag kunna dimma ner spänningen steglöst. Tänkte använda en PWM-krets som genererar en pwm-signal med justerbar Duty för att styra en Mosfet som driver lampan. Men vet inte riktigt hur jag skall placera lampan och Mosfeten.
Hoppas det blev tydligare nu
Har en halogen lampa för 12 V och tillgång till 12 V från batteri. För att spara energi vill jag kunna dimma ner spänningen steglöst. Tänkte använda en PWM-krets som genererar en pwm-signal med justerbar Duty för att styra en Mosfet som driver lampan. Men vet inte riktigt hur jag skall placera lampan och Mosfeten.
Hoppas det blev tydligare nu
OK, har precis fått ihop kopplingen och testat... problemet jag hade förut idag (som gav mig tvivel) var att Pwm-IC'n var varit i Under-voltage lockout state. Tänkte inte på det;)
Men jag funderar på hur man kan minska pulseringens påverkan på lampan, alltså det darrande ljuset och högfrekventa ljudet när man styr ner duty under ca 50-60 %.
Kanske blir det bättre om man höjer eller sänker pwm-frekv?
Eller koppla in en liten konding?
Men jag funderar på hur man kan minska pulseringens påverkan på lampan, alltså det darrande ljuset och högfrekventa ljudet när man styr ner duty under ca 50-60 %.
Kanske blir det bättre om man höjer eller sänker pwm-frekv?
Eller koppla in en liten konding?
hmm.. det blir varmt..
Lampan drar ca 3.0 - 3.4 A, Spänningskällan varierar mellan ca 12 och 15 V.
Använder en MosFet med 0,07 ohm ledresistans och hög strömtålighet.
P=R*I*I ==> P= 0,07*3*3= 0,63 W
Men Fet'en blir ändå väldigt varm. Använder den PWM på gaten (duty 60-99 %)
Det är kopplat såhär: matning plus till lampan, matning minus till Source, Drain till lampan.
Har jag tänkt fel någonstans?
EDIT: PWM-frekv: 10 kHz
Lampan drar ca 3.0 - 3.4 A, Spänningskällan varierar mellan ca 12 och 15 V.
Använder en MosFet med 0,07 ohm ledresistans och hög strömtålighet.
P=R*I*I ==> P= 0,07*3*3= 0,63 W
Men Fet'en blir ändå väldigt varm. Använder den PWM på gaten (duty 60-99 %)
Det är kopplat såhär: matning plus till lampan, matning minus till Source, Drain till lampan.
Har jag tänkt fel någonstans?
EDIT: PWM-frekv: 10 kHz
Driver du MosFeten direckt från microkontrollen?
Där har du felet, Mikrokontrollen hinner inte slå på MosFeten tillräckligt snabbt, den befinner sig i ett halvledande läge som den inte bör befina sig i.
Sätt en MosFet drivare imellan.
Kör du redan med drivare, då måste du byta till tåligare MosFet.
Stämmer inte nån av påståendena så är det svårt att gissa mera utan exakt kopplings schema och exakt komponentbeskrivning.
Där har du felet, Mikrokontrollen hinner inte slå på MosFeten tillräckligt snabbt, den befinner sig i ett halvledande läge som den inte bör befina sig i.
Sätt en MosFet drivare imellan.
Kör du redan med drivare, då måste du byta till tåligare MosFet.
Stämmer inte nån av påståendena så är det svårt att gissa mera utan exakt kopplings schema och exakt komponentbeskrivning.
- bengt-re
- EF Sponsor
- Inlägg: 4829
- Blev medlem: 4 april 2005, 16:18:59
- Skype: bengt-re
- Ort: Söder om söder
- Kontakt:
Dessutom även OM man switchar hårt så blir det alltid lite switchförluster. En effekt som du kanske inte tänkt på är att lampan är duktigt olinjär i sin strömförbrukning så den drar mer ström kall än vad man kanske tror. Men som sagt - switcha hårdare. Passa på att titta på hur switchningen blir (stig/fall til och om du får några resonanser)
Det handlar inte om att mikrokontrollern inte hinner med. Det är strömmen som kan vara för liten ut från mikrokontrollern för att driva FET:en. En FET som switchas med hög frekvens är väldigt trögdriven på gaten p.g.a kapacitanser. Då ligger FET:en i mellanlägen (varken bottnad eller öppen) under långa tider och gernererar mycket värme.
-
- Inlägg: 75
- Blev medlem: 4 december 2003, 19:14:27
- Ort: Byn
Jo, jag känner till hur man bör driva en Fet, har byggt motorkontrollers med bryggdrivare osv. Tänkte slippa det här.
Har testat med 2 olika IRF3315 och RFP12N10L. Började med den sistnämnda som skall kunna drivas direkt av ttl, så jag tänkte att de kanske kan gå. den blev varm så jag tesade med irf3315 som har lägre Rdson.
Har egentligen inget krav på pwm-frekv.. Kan jag undvika problemet om jag sänker frekvensen till under 100 Hz?
Har testat med 2 olika IRF3315 och RFP12N10L. Började med den sistnämnda som skall kunna drivas direkt av ttl, så jag tänkte att de kanske kan gå. den blev varm så jag tesade med irf3315 som har lägre Rdson.
Har egentligen inget krav på pwm-frekv.. Kan jag undvika problemet om jag sänker frekvensen till under 100 Hz?